Alicante’s signature rice dish, cooked with rabbit, chicken and snails over vine cuttings. It is prized for its smoky flavour and festival roots.
Dry rice cooked in fish stock with cuttlefish, prawns and monkfish, often finished with aioli. A classic coastal dish across Alicante province.
Creamy rice with salt cod and cauliflower, especially linked to Lent and home cooking in Alicante. Simple ingredients give it a deeply local character.

Italy’s capital city, Rome, ranks fourth in the most populated cities of the European Union. It serves many residents and visitors who may travel often to other destinations. Alicante is also one of the oldest cities found in Spain’s southern coast that serves as a popular tourist attraction center. Flying is an excellent way of traveling from Rome to Alicante. Passengers can cover the 1170 kilometers between these two cities through direct flights that take only two hours five minutes. There are at least six direct flights leaving Rome for Alicante on a weekly basis with two departures on the weekend. These flights from Rome to Alicante are offered by airlines such as Iberia, Ryanair and vueling. Flights tend to leave Rome in the afternoon, with a few early evening departures. The departure airport for this journey may either be the Leonardo da Vinci airport found in Rome Fiumicino or Rome Ciampino airport. Airplanes then land at Alicante Elche airport.
Direct flights from Rome to Alicante are offered by Iberia and Ryanair airlines on a weekly basis. Other airlines serving this route include vueling, Air Europa, Norweigan, TAP Portugal and Brussels Airlines though these services tend to be indirect and require one transfer during the journey.
Time spent on this journey may vary depending on the airline but the fastest direct flight takes two hours five minutes when traveling via Ryanair. Direct flights with Iberia airlines take two hours 15 minutes. Other airlines with stopovers on the way travel for more than four hours on this route. The fastest indirect option is the vueling service that takes just shy of five hours and travels via Barcelona.
Throughout the week passengers can expect up to six direct departures, averaging at approximately one per day usually departing in the evening. There are two departures on the weekend which means that a plane flies from Rome to Alicante every day with no changes on the way. There are more than 15 connecting services offered per day.
Departure Airport: Leornado da Vinci and Rome Ciampino (CIA) are the departure airports for flights from Rome to Alicante. Trains are an effective way of getting to these airports from the city center within 30 minutes. Bus shuttles are also available, taking approximately an hour on this route. Parking spaces are available in these two airports for those who use taxis, car rentals or personal vehicles to get to the airports. Travelers can use amenities such as shopping areas, restaurants, WC facilities, drug stores, free WiFi and relaxation areas as they await the departure flight.
Arrival Airport: Planes land at Alicante Elche Airport, situated eight kilometers from Alicante. Travelers can reach Mercado and Lucero stations in Alicante by urban bus line C6 that offers services available 24 hours a day. This journey take around 15 minutes and ends at the city’s train station. It is also possible to rent a car or travel by taxi to the city center. Amenities in this airport include WC facilities, medical services, a children’s playground, currency exchange offices, VIP lounges, cafeterias, shops, free WiFi and restaurants and a waiting room with sockets for those with devices.
